Let It Be

I held his hand through storms at night,
He clung to me with quiet might.
The world was loud, but we stayed still,
Two hearts that bent with stubborn will.
He whispered low, just let it be,
Like waves that break, then beg the sea.
We weren’t unscarred, but we were free
And that was more than fate to me.
